About

Dr. Minsuk Jun is a leading figure in reconstructive urology, with a focused expertise in robotic ureteral surgery. His major contributions center on advancing minimally invasive techniques for managing complex ureteral strictures, particularly those involving long segments of the proximal ureter. Dr. Jun’s pivotal work, "Intermediate-term outcomes after robotic ureteral reconstruction for long-segment (≥4 centimeters) strictures in the proximal ureter," published in 2020, has garnered 21 citations, establishing a benchmark for the field. This multi-institutional study, leveraging the Collaborative of Reconstructive Robotic Ureteral Surgery (CORRUS) database, demonstrated that robotic reconstruction is a safe and effective alternative to open surgery for these challenging cases, offering durable intermediate-term results. By systematically evaluating outcomes for strictures ≥4 cm, Dr. Jun has provided critical evidence that expands the indications for robotic repair, reducing patient morbidity.
